Pool Deck Resurfacing in Miami Dade County, FL
Pool deck resurfacing services involve restoring and enhancing the surface surrounding a swimming pool, providing a fresh, durable, and attractive finish. This process can include removing old, worn-out surfaces and applying new materials such as concrete overlays, stamped concrete, or textured finishes. Property owners often request this service when their existing pool deck shows signs of cracking, staining, or deterioration, or when they want to update the appearance to match their landscape design. Projects typically cover areas around residential pools, including walkways, patios, and coping edges, helping to improve safety and aesthetics.
Before requesting pool deck resurfacing, property owners usually want to understand the different material options available, the expected durability, and how the new surface can complement their outdoor space. It's also important to consider the current condition of the existing surface and any necessary preparatory work, such as cleaning or repairs, to ensure a long-lasting result. Clarifying the scope of work, including surface texture and color choices, can help homeowners achieve a finished look that enhances both the functionality and visual appeal of their pool area.

Common Pool Deck Resurfacing Jobs
Pool deck resurfacing involves restoring and updating the surface around a swimming pool for improved appearance and safety.
Concrete resurfacing can repair cracks, stains, and uneven areas on existing pool decks.
Stamped and textured overlays add decorative patterns and slip-resistant surfaces to enhance curb appeal.
Polyurethane and acrylic coatings provide durable, weather-resistant finishes that extend the lifespan of the deck.
Epoxy and paint applications refresh faded or chipped surfaces with vibrant, long-lasting colors.
Surface preparation and sealing ensure a smooth, sealed finish that protects against water damage and wear.
Pool Deck Resurfacing Questions
What is pool deck resurfacing? Pool deck resurfacing involves applying a new finish to improve the appearance and durability of the existing pool area surface.
What types of materials are used for resurfacing? Common materials include concrete overlays, stamped concrete, and acrylic coatings, chosen for their durability and aesthetic appeal.
How does resurfacing enhance safety around the pool? Resurfacing can include slip-resistant finishes that help prevent accidents and improve traction in wet conditions.
Is resurfacing suitable for all pool deck surfaces? Resurfacing works best on existing concrete or similar surfaces that are in good condition and free of major cracks or damage.
